In order to solve the problem of combining pump hydraulic model with motor electromagnetic calculation model, this paper adopts BP neural network combined with genetic algorithms (GA-BP) to fit the model of pump hydraulic performance. Combine pump GA-BP model with motor electromagnetic calculation model to establish an integrated model. The main work is as follows:1. Based on the basic principle of BP neural network and genetic algorithm, this paper research the method which used to optimize the structure, weight, threshold of BP neural network with genetic algorithm. And write GA-BP model of water pump with C language;2. Comparing and analysis the results of GA-BP model and basic BP neural network model, include accuracy,speed, scale of the network and the ability of generalization, to verify the effectiveness of the method;3. The motor electromagnetic model and pump hydraulic model are connected with the interface variables, to establish a pump machine integrated model.
